Dispatch

The Carver Police Department maintains a 24 hour Public Safety Communications Center, which is staffed with one dispatcher who handles Police, Fire and Medical calls. The communications center is the primary answering point for all landline emergency 911 calls and cellular 911 transfers from the State Police, as well as all business lines including police and fire. Dispatchers are trained in E911, CJIS, EMD (Emergency Medical Dispatching) and Telecommunicator 1.

Our dispatchers are capable of handling stressful incidents and situations in a calm and professional manner. Dispatchers utilize a touch screen dispatch console to easily and effectively alert and communicate with Police, Fire, EMS, Mutual Aid and the Carver Department of Public Works.
